Teatro en Inglés

Todos los años gracias a las Concejalías de Educación y Cultura tenemos la oportunidad de disfrutar de fantásticas obras de teatro en inglés con la compañia Face to Face

Jack and the Giant: 1º y  2º de primaria


Jack, un chico de familia humilde intercambia la vaca de su familia por unas alubias mágicas. Las alubias crecen por la noche y se convierten en un gigantesco árbol. Jack escala el árbol hasta llegar a un palacio en las nubes cuyo inquilino es un gigante feroz y cruel. ¿Conseguirá Jack hacerse amigo del gigante? 


3º y 4º - In the Jungle ! Tarzan 

The story is inspired by Edgar Rice Burroughs’ famous series of novels. The play follows the adventures of a small boy whose parents die when an aeroplane crashes in the jungle. 

The only survivor is a small boy who is adopted by monkeys. That boy grows up to become Tarzan, Lord of the Apes. Meanwhile Jane Goodall, a nature-loving documentary maker, and her fiancée, Archibald Porter III the hunter, are on an expedition in the jungle. Tarzan’s best friend Cheetah, a cute but naughty monkey, is kidnapped by Archie and taken to Timbuktu. Can Tarzan save Cheetah? Will Tarzan be civilized? Will Jane find true love? Face 2 Face take the audience on the safari of a life time in search of the answers! Here is an extract of dialogue from the show, in which Tarzan meets Jane for the first time. 


5º y 6º ¡Todos a bordo del Orient Express!

The story begins in Paris, at the Louvre museum. A thief steals the White Tiger Diamond and boards the Orient Express train, destination Moscow. The world famous detective, Inspector Cluelez, finds a train ticket and a glove at the scene of the crime. He boards the train, too, hoping to find the diamond thief.   But the beautiful Russian criminal, Anastasia, outsmarts the detective and turns the journey into an adventure he will remember for the rest of his life…
